Kaduna State Governor Son Shades Nnamdi Kanu

Son of Kaduna State Governor, Bashir El-Rufai  mocked leader of the Indigenous People of Biafra(IPOB) Nnamdi Kanu, in a tweet on Tuesday suggested that Kanu be locked up in a cell with a cow after news of the IPOB leader’s arrest broke.

His tweet, in which he tagged Nigeria’s president, Muhammadu Buhari, reads

”He should be locked in a cell with a cow, please @MBuhari.”

In another Tweet, Bashir described Kanu as a hooligan, noting that there are people who are displeased with the latest development but are scared to talk.

He said

 “There are those that will be upset this hooligan was arrested, but will be too cowardly to express it. Victory for the country. May we all continue to progress in unison.”

His comments, however, have continued to spark outrage, as many Nigerians tackled him for not being constructive in his criticisms. Many opined that Bashir was well-educated enough to avoid being sentimental on such issues while some blasted him, describing him as a privileged one who has refused to make good use of his education
